Distribution Manager roles in the U.S. qualify for E-3 visa sponsorship when the position requires a bachelor's degree in supply chain, logistics, business, or a related field. The E-3 has no lottery and no annual cap, making it a reliable path for Australian professionals with a qualifying job offer.

Tips for Finding E-3 Visa Sponsorship as a Distribution Manager

Frame your degree for U.S. specialty occupation standards

Australian three-year bachelor's degrees in supply chain, logistics, or business are generally accepted as equivalent to U.S. four-year degrees. Document your credential equivalency before applying so employers don't raise specialty occupation concerns during the LCA stage.

Target employers with active import or export operations

Companies with cross-border supply chains, third-party logistics contracts, or distribution center networks are structured to handle visa sponsorship. Search DOL's Foreign Labor Application Gateway disclosure data to confirm which employers have filed LCAs for logistics and operations roles.

Get the LCA filed before your consulate appointment

Your employer must file a certified Labor Condition Application with DOL before you can book your visa interview. Most delays happen here, not at the consulate. Use Migrate Mate's E-3 filing service to handle your LCA and visa paperwork so the sequence doesn't stall your start date.

Prepare an org chart showing direct reports and scope

Consular officers assessing specialty occupation for distribution roles want evidence that the position requires a specific degree, not just managerial experience. An org chart showing budget authority, vendor relationships, and team structure strengthens your case at the interview.

Address dual intent directly if you're renewing repeatedly

The E-3 is a nonimmigrant visa, meaning officers can question immigrant intent if you've renewed several times or your employer has begun green card discussions. Have a clear, factual answer about your current status and near-term plans before entering the interview.

Confirm your job offer letter meets USCIS wage requirements

The offer letter must state a salary at or above the DOL prevailing wage for the role and location. Distribution Manager wages vary significantly by metro area, so your employer should verify the correct wage level before issuing the offer to avoid LCA complications.

Does a Distribution Manager role qualify as a specialty occupation for the E-3?

It qualifies when the position requires a bachelor's degree or higher in a specific field such as supply chain management, logistics, or business administration. Roles focused purely on warehouse supervision or operations without a degree requirement may not meet the specialty occupation threshold. The job description and offer letter both need to reflect the degree requirement clearly.

How does the E-3 compare to the H-1B for Distribution Manager roles?

The E-3 has no annual lottery and no cap, so you can apply as soon as you have a qualifying job offer. The H-1B is subject to an annual lottery with roughly a one-in-four selection rate, which means most applicants wait years for a slot. For Australian nationals in distribution and logistics, the E-3 is a direct path where H-1B is a gamble.

Can I change employers while on an E-3 as a Distribution Manager?

Yes, but you need to restart the process with the new employer. They must file a new LCA with DOL and you'll need to apply for a new E-3 visa at a U.S. consulate in Australia before starting the new role. You can't simply transfer the visa. Build enough lead time into your transition so the new LCA is certified before you resign.
